PacketWave Base Station and Subscriber
Units Installation Instructions
The PacketWave 1000 and 100 Series Base Station and Subscriber Units require
outdoor units, a Radio and Antenna for each Wireless Sub-System (WSS) and an
Integrated Radio/Antenna for the Subscriber Unit. On both the Base Station and
Subscriber outdoor units must be mounted and installed for proper operation. Each
Base Station Unit Antenna is connected to a Base Station Radio Unit using two RF N-
Type female connectors. For both the Base Station and Subscriber Units power and
Intermediate Frequency (IF) signals to the radio unit are supplied, through the RG-6
cable. A CAT5 E Ethernet control cable also connects the indoor unit to the outdoor
radio unit.
